Electric-arc resistant face shield or lens including ir-blocking inorganic nanoparticles
Abstract
A transparent electric-arc resistant composition is produced by preparing crystalline tungsten bronze nanoparticles and homogenously dispersing the nanoparticles in a transparent plastic matrix. The crystalline tungsten bronze nanoparticles are prepared by homogeneously mixing an aqueous solution of soluble tungsten and cesium salts and then drying the solution. The dried solution is then heated in a reducing gas or inert gas atmosphere to form crystalline tungsten bronze nanoparticles. Thereafter, a dispersion agent is added and the nanoparticles are dispersed in a liquid solvent medium by wet milling to form a dispersion mixture. The dispersion mixture is then mixed with polymer pellets to form a polymer mixture, and the polymer mixture is then extruded to yield polymer pellets containing highly homogeneously dispersed inorganic nanoparticles. During or after dispersion, additional particles, dyes, heat stabilizers or UV absorbers, may be added. A lens or shield is then molded from the polymer pellets.
